AI Infrastructure Hit by Delays: What Oracle‘s ‌Troubles Signal for the Future

Recent news of ⁤delays in major data center projects is sending ripples through the​ AI industry, triggering a sell-off ⁢of companies reliant on AI infrastructure. While a one-year pushback from 2027 to 2028 might ​seem minor, it represents a critical setback for companies racing to monetize their AI investments. The‌ clock is ticking, and these delays could⁣ significantly impact ⁤the timeline for‌ turning enterprising visions into ⁣profitable realities.

The pressure to​ Deliver – and the ⁢Risks of Delay

For AI companies, the pressure to ⁢demonstrate revenue is immense. Many are operating ​with substantial losses, relying ‍on continued investment to fuel advancement. A year’s delay in data center completion translates directly ⁢into:

* ‌ A slower pace of AI model training.
* Delayed deployment of AI-powered tools.
* Increased uncertainty ⁤about the return on‍ massive capital expenditures.

Essentially, it prolongs the period of proving whether the ⁢current AI boom is built on solid foundations or simply hype.

Real-World Challenges: Beyond ⁤Just Time

These delays aren’t simply a matter of scheduling. Several tangible factors are contributing to the slowdown:

* Construction Labor Shortages: The surge in data center construction has​ created a fierce⁣ competition for skilled workers, driving ⁣up labor costs.
* Tariffs on Materials: Trump-era tariffs are increasing the cost‍ of essential construction materials, adding billions to the overall‍ buildout expenses – ​potentially impacting U.S. competitiveness‍ in AI.‌ Recent reports indicate AI data centers have already absorbed $6 billion in tariffs this year alone.
* ⁣ Supply⁣ chain Constraints: Obtaining necessary ⁣components ⁢and materials is ⁣proving more arduous and⁤ expensive than anticipated.

oracle: A Bellwether for AI Market Confidence

Oracle’s recent performance has consistently served as a​ barometer for market sentiment surrounding AI. Despite a lackluster quarterly earnings report in‍ September – missing revenue and earnings ⁤projections with flat year-over-year net income – the company’s stock unexpectedly​ soared.

This surge was fueled by ‌a massive $455 ​billion in remaining performance ⁤obligations, largely stemming from data center agreements with OpenAI.However, ⁣the ‌current delays are casting ⁤doubt on‍ the certainty of these commitments. ​

Stargate and Beyond: Cracks in the Foundation?

Concerns about Oracle’s deals aren’t new. The ambitious “Stargate” project, a collaboration between Oracle ⁢and OpenAI, has reportedly been experiencing meaningful⁢ slowdowns.Despite these issues,OpenAI CEO Sam Altman ‌continued to announce further​ investments in the project,initially boosting market confidence.

Now, Wall Street ⁤is beginning to question whether these announcements translate into tangible progress. The market is realizing that simply announcing multi-billion-dollar deals doesn’t guarantee their successful completion.
